FALSE/TRUE. Control use of second clock correction sequence.
FALSE: Clock correction uses only one clock correction sequence
defined by CLK_COR_SEQ_1_1... 4, OR one 8-byte sequence
defined by CLK_COR_SEQ_1_1... 4 and CLK_COR_SEQ_2_1... 4
Boolean
in combination.
TRUE: Clock correction uses two clock correction sequences
defined by CLK_COR_SEQ_1_1... 4 and CLK_COR_SEQ_2_1... 4,
as further constrained by CLK_COR_SEQ_LEN.

Integer (1, 2, 4) controls the alignment of detected commas within the
transceiver's 4-byte-wide data path.
1 = Aligns commas within a 10-bit alignment range. As a result,
the comma is aligned to any byte in the transceivers internal
Integer
data path.
2 = Aligns commas to any 2-byte boundary.
4 = Aligns commas to any 4-byte boundary.
FALSE/TRUE.
FALSE: Comma alignment is set for 10 bits.
Boolean
TRUE: Comma alignment is set for 32 bits. This is used for SONET
alignment applications.
